John Howard takes Limited Late Model victory at Toccoa

John Howard drove to the Limited Late Model victory on Saturday night at Georgia’s historic Toccoa Raceway.

The Clayton, Georgia racer held off Brett Shook to score the win at the 5/16-mile clay speedway.

Andrew Benfield finished in third, with Austin Fox in fourth, and David Conley in fifth.

In other action, John Harrison was flagged the winner of the 602 Sportsman feature, but as disqualified post race. That moved Rusty House to the win, with Frankie Beard in second, Crandall Turner in third, Rick Smith in fourth, and Frankie Barrett in fifth.

Clayton Turner was the winner in the Open Wheel Modified feature. Grayson Wells, Cy Strickland, Chris Nickerson, and Josh Thurmond rounded out the top five.

Evan Brown edged out Chris Thomas to win the Modified Street feature, with Rex Hambrick third, Billy Buffington fourth, and Berry Tollison fifth.

Terry Calhoun topped the Pro Truck feature for the victory. Bill Pullum crossed the line in second, with Sammy Calhoun in third, Benjamin Stewart in fourth, and Matthew Denton in fifth.

Dylan Bartlett crossed the finish line ahead of Bryan Tullis for the 602 Chargers victory. Marcus Rider followed in third, with Jay Motes in fourth, and Corey Wood in fifth.

Brady Hunt took the checkered flag first in the Stock 8 feature, but lost the win with a post-race disqualification. That moved Cameron Collett to the win, with Zack Stewart second, Mason Johnson third, Terry Calhoun fourth, and Haydne Collett fifth.

Ryan Crawford scored the Stock 4 feature win. Harley Holden followed in second, Kenny Phillips in third, Tyler Fortner in fourth, and Scott Hollars in fifth.

Joe Cabe was the winner in the Front Wheel Drive feature, with Joey Cabe in second, followed by Jackie Holden in third, Austin Kinsey in fourth, and Wayne Glenn in fifth.

Toccoa Raceway returns to action on Saturday, May 13. For more information, visit ToccoaRaceway.org.
